Simple Blue eyeliner eye makeup tutorial for brown eyes!


Simple Blue eyeliner eye makeup tutorial for brown eyes!
Hi Girlz, here I am with another tutorial which is easy to follow and recreate. It's a very basic look that's perfect for a daytime. It's a beautiful blue eyeliner makeup tutorial specially for brown eyes!
So lets begin...............
Also read- First eye makeup tutorial
  1. Prep your eyes with concealer and a primer if you need.
  2. Apply a light gold eye shadow all over your lid and a light cream eye shadow onto the brow bone.
  3. Now carefully apply the blue eyeliner I am using (Maybelline), the thickness and shape depends on you. But i usually prefer winged eyes.
  4. Line your waterline with black kohl smudging it a little bit on the lower lash line to give a softer look, curl and coat your eyelashes with 2 coats of mascara. You are good to go!

Glamour Girlz- first eye makeup tutorial using Maybelline color tattoo's.

 Hello girls, This is a the very first time I am doing an eye makeup tutorial on this blog. I hope you'll like it and will give it a try when going to a party, wedding or any other occasion. It's a gold and and deep burgundy look. I have created this look using Maybelline Color Tattoo's in the shades Bold Gold and Pomegranate Punk.
So lets begin with the tutorial!
  • Prep your eyes with with a concealer. If your eye area is dry then before starting apply a good moisturizing eye cream like Himalaya under eye cream. You can also use a primer if you have one to make your shades look more pigmented. However, you don't need a primer while using Maybelline color tattoos. I filled my eye brows with Rimmel eye brow pencil.

  • Then I applied Maybelline Color Tattoo Bold Gold all over my eyelid using my fingers since I told you in my earlier post that these tattoos are difficult to be applied with brush. And after that I applied Pomegranate Punk which is a dark color onto my outer corner and crease and blended it with the Gold eye shadow using the blending brush. I also added a bit of the purplish/burgundy shade from the Lakme quad-let on top of Pomegranate punk. Plus I highlighted my brow bone with light creamy shade from the MUA palette.
